Planning begins for the new headquarters of global law firm in the Caribbean
January 31st, 2008
Woods Bagot has secured the commission for the new headquarters of global law firm, Walkers, in the Cayman Islands.
The seven-storey building will stand on stilts, designed to withstand hurricanes while incorporating environmental features such as solar heating.
The 10,000m2 project has been designed in conjunction with London-based firm, Sall Cullinan and Buck, and will be completed in January 2009.
